The State of New Hampshire, Department of Natural and Cultural Resources, Division of Parks and Recreation, is seeking a qualified vendor to provide comprehensive industrial motor and electrical control maintenance for the snowmaking system at Cannon Mountain Ski Area. The scope of work includes preventive maintenance, inspection, diagnostic testing, repair, overhaul, and emergency response for industrial electric motors ranging from 50 HP to 1,250 HP from manufacturers such as GE, US Motors, Siemens, TECO, and Marathon. The selected vendor must provide all necessary labor, supervision, tools, and materials, ensuring all work adheres to manufacturer recommendations, industry standards, and applicable safety regulations. The contract is envisioned as a three-year agreement starting November 15, 2026, with the state holding an option for two additional one-year extensions, pending approval from the NH Governor and Executive Council. Award decisions will be based on the best overall value, with evaluation weighted toward pricing (50%), experience and qualifications (25%), technical approach (15%), and references (10%). Vendors must provide proof of Commercial General Liability and Workers' Compensation insurance and submit a detailed proposal including a pricing sheet for labor rates, shop services, and parts markups. The final agreement will be based on the State of New Hampshire Form P-37.

The Pearl Harbor Naval Shipyard & Intermediate Maintenance Facility is seeking a qualified contractor to provide comprehensive maintenance, repair, and calibration services for a single Studer S41 CNC grinding machine under a firm fixed-price contract with a base period of one year and four optional one-year extensions, totaling up to five years of performance from March 23, 2026, to March 22, 2031. The solicitation, numbered N32253-26-Q-0031 and amended on April 23, 2026, requires offerings to be submitted via email to designated points of contact no later than March 10, 2026, and mandates that all offerors maintain active registration in the System for Award Management through the award date. Offerors must deliver a detailed technical proposal, not exceeding ten pages, demonstrating a clear and thorough understanding of the Performance Work Statement, including compliance with safety, environmental, security, and OPSEC protocols outlined in multiple appendices. Only technically acceptable submissions will proceed to price evaluation, with award determined strictly on a lowest price technically acceptable basis. All pricing must include labor, travel, and materials in accordance with DoD Joint Travel Regulations and FAR 31.205-46, and must be itemized using the provided template or equivalent format. The contractor must be certified to perform services on industrial machinery, with the NAICS code 811310 assigning a $12.5 million size standard. The contract includes mandatory compliance with a robust set of FAR and DFARS clauses, including provisions related to cybersecurity, labor standards, whistleblower rights, export controls, and security protocols for handling sensitive naval nuclear propulsion information. Personnel must be U.S. citizens, obtain appropriate site access badges based on work areas (Green, Yellow, or Red), complete mandatory security orientation, and submit prior visit requests through official channels. Compliance with NIST SP 800-171 and ISO/IEC 17025 or ANSI/NCSL Z540 calibration standards is required, along with reporting of all repairs and maintenance activities and submission of inspection reports within five business days. All replaced parts become government property and must be delivered accordingly. Invoicing must be conducted exclusively through Wide Area WorkFlow, and the contract explicitly removes any option to extend beyond the five-year maximum. Pearl Harbor Naval Shipyard & Intermediate Maintenance Facility (PHNSY & IMF) is a US Navy regional industrial center that maintains, overhauls and repairs various vessels of the US Navy. Its industrial operations provide the US naval forces with a wide range of services and resources located on the island of Oahu, Hawaii, with direct and indirect support to submarines, surface vessels and shore-based activities in the Pacific.


PHNSY & IMF requires a contractor to supply a Manufacturer Trained and Certified Technician to repair one (1) Studer S41 CNC grinding machine to a fully operational condition. The Contractor shall provide annual preventive maintenance, calibration, and remedial service, to include an inspection report of work performed. Additional details and specifications can be found in the attached Performance Work Statement (PWS).


The tentative period of performance for this service is 03/23/2026 to 03/22/2031. The period of performance includes a base and four (4) option years. If you are unable to meet the period of performance date, please submit soonest availability with submission of quotation.


The applicable North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) code assigned to this procurement is 811310 –Commercial and Industrial Machinery and Equipment (except Automotive and Electronic) Repair and Maintenance; size standard for this NAICS is $12,500,000. The Product Service Code is J049 – Maintenance, Repair and Rebuilding of Equipment: Maintenance and Repair Shop Equipment.
